Offshore / Renewables

Innovate UK KTN supports the offshore wind industry as a major contributor to the ORE Catapult innovation hub funded by BEIS, as well as supporting the companies who are making applications for funding for offshore renewables.

The team has helped with introductions and collaborations for projects with the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) installing offshore energy.

We have also supported three overseas missions to Canada, China, South Korea and Japan to establish the potential for UK companies to work in collaboration: from this we have a Memorandum of Understanding from a Japanese research centre and joint projects with the US.

Innovate UK KTN sits on the advisory board of The EPSRC Centre for Doctoral Training in Renewable Energy Northeast Universities.
